Leadership Review Briefing — Prepared for the Incoming Director

Over the past two quarters, Merrowfield Systems has evaluated a potential acquisition of Quillane Analytics, a small firm whose forecasting engine complements our Harborline platform. Due diligence has surfaced manageable integration risks and a strong retention case for their engineering team. Valuation discussions remain preliminary. The board has asked that strategic rationale be circulated only to this review. That rationale follows below in confidence.

internal memo for kahop-yajof: The steering committee signed off on a budget of $12.6 million for Project Jorwyn. The renewal with Quenoxox Logistics closes at $16.8 million a year, 48 percent above the last contract.

Hi folks — quick heads-up from the front desk. We've set up a guest Wi-Fi desk beside reception so visitors stop queueing at our counter for network help. Could facilities keep an eye on the signage and restock the printed instructions when they run low? The cabinet under the desk holds spares, and it locks automatically, so you'll need the code, which is this one.

door code, yagap-bahof: bdg-O-05

## WebSocket Compression: Who to Ping

So you're on call and someone wants permessage-deflate turned on for Streamlane. Short version: it saves bandwidth but spikes CPU on the gateway pods, and we've been burned before. Don't flip the flag solo — the tradeoffs are tracked in the Streamlane perf doc. Questions or a real emergency? Ping the gateway crew at the address below.

pager mailbox: silael.sorwyn.tamius@zemvarsys.corp